Possible Causes of Water Damage
Water damage in your home or business can stem from various sources, often unexpected and disruptive. Common causes include burst pipes, leaking appliances, or severe weather events such as heavy rains and storms that overwhelm drainage systems. Identifying the root cause is crucial for effective repair and prevention.
Additionally, structural issues like roof leaks, foundation cracks, or faulty plumbing can contribute to ongoing water intrusion. Over time, these issues may worsen if not promptly addressed, leading to extensive damage to possessions and the propertyโs foundation. How do I know if my water damage is classified as clean or contaminated water?
We assess the source and quality of the water involved. Clean water typically comes from broken pipes or rain, while contaminated water might result from sewage or stagnant pools. Proper classification safeguards health and guides our cleaning methods.

What are the risks of not properly classifying water damage?
Incorrect classification can lead to inadequate drying, ongoing mold growth, or structural deterioration. Proper classification ensures appropriate remediation steps are taken, safeguarding your property and health.
